Former AMERICAN IDOL contestant JAMES DURBIN will release his Wind-Up Records debut, Memories Of A Beautiful Disaster, on November 21st. It includes collaborations with MÖTLEY CRÜE’s Mick Mars, James Michael (SIXX: A.M, Mötley Crüe), Marti Frederiksen (AEROSMITH, OZZY OSBOURNE) and HARDCORE SUPERSTAR.

Durbin, who came in fourth on American Idol, was the season’s resident rocker who had performed songs by the likes of JUDAS PRIEST, SAMMY HAGAR and 30 SECONDS TO MARS - many for the first time on the Idol stage. On the American Idol summer tour, his set included MUSE’s 'Uprising' and GUNS N' ROSES’ 'Sweet Child O' Mine.'
